Оглавление
Для различных целей вам может потребоваться найти количество вхождений между двумя датами. Вы можете легко получить значение count, если знаете технику. Сегодня, в этой статье, мы продемонстрируем следующее 4 подходящие примеры для подсчета ( COUNTIF ) между двумя датами в Excel. Если вам это тоже интересно, скачайте нашу рабочую тетрадь для практики и следуйте за нами.
Скачать Практическое пособие
Скачайте эту рабочую тетрадь для практики, пока вы читаете эту статью.
Функция COUNTIF с критериями.xlsx
4 подходящих примера использования COUNTIF между двумя датами в Excel
Для демонстрации примеров мы рассматриваем набор данных из 12 людей и дату их рождения. Имя человека находится в колонке B , а дата их рождения находится в столбце C Подсчитаем количество лет, указанных в столбце E .
1. Вставка дат непосредственно в функцию COUNTIF
В первом примере мы собираемся непосредственно ввести даты в функция COUNTIFS для подсчета количества дат. Ниже приведены шаги для выполнения этого примера:
📌 Шаги:
- Прежде всего, выберите ячейку F5 .
- Теперь запишите в ячейке следующую формулу.
=COUNTIFS($C$5:$C$16,">=01-01-1990",$C$5:$C$16,"<=12-13-1990")
- Нажмите Войти .
- Аналогичным образом введите формулу такого же типа в остальную часть ячейки с F6:F10 .
- Вы получите все подсчитанные значения в нужной нам ячейке.
Таким образом, мы можем сказать, что наша формула работает идеально, и мы можем использовать КОУНТИФЫ функция для подсчета между двумя датами.
Читать далее: Как использовать в Excel COUNTIF, не содержащий нескольких критериев
2. Объединить функцию COUNTIF с функцией DATE
Во втором примере мы будем использовать ДАТА и КОУНТИФЫ функции для подсчета количества дат. Шаги для завершения этого примера приведены ниже:
📌 Шаги:
- Сначала выберите ячейку F5 .
- После этого запишите в ячейке следующую формулу.
=COUNTIFS($C$5:$C$16,">="&DATE(E5,1,1),$C$5:$C$16,"<="&DATE(E5,12,31))
- Затем нажмите Войти .
- Затем перетащите Наполнительная рукоятка значок , чтобы скопировать формулу в ячейку F10 .
- Вы заметите, что формула оценивает количество лет в нужных нам ячейках.
Следовательно, мы можем сказать, что наша формула работает эффективно, и мы можем использовать КОУНТИФЫ функция для подсчета между двумя датами.
🔎 Разбивка формулы
Мы разбиваем формулу для ячейки F5 .
👉
DATE(E5,1,1) : The ДАТА функция преобразует числовое значение в значение даты. Здесь значение имеет вид 1/1/1990 .
👉
DATE(E5,12,31) : The ДАТА функция преобразует числовое значение в значение даты. Для этой функции значение будет таким 12/31/1990 .
👉
COUNTIFS($C$5:$C$16,">="&DATE(E5,1,1),$C$5:$C$16,"<="&DATE(E5,12,31)) : The КОУНТИФЫ Функция подсчитает те значения дат, которые лежат между датой 1/1/1990 и 12/31/1990 Здесь значение 1 .
Читать далее: Дата COUNTIF в течение 7 дней
Похожие чтения
- Excel COUNTIFS не работает (7 причин с решениями)
- COUNTIF и COUNTIFS в Excel (4 примера)
- Функция VBA COUNTIF в Excel (6 примеров)
- Как использовать COUNTIF с WEEKDAY в Excel
- Подсчет пустых ячеек с помощью функции COUNTIF в Excel: 2 примера
3. Подсчет количества дат с помощью функции SUMPRODUCT
В следующем примере SUMPRODUCT и DATEVALUE Функции помогут нам подсчитать количество дат. Шаги для выполнения этого примера показаны ниже:
📌 Шаги:
- Сначала выберите ячейку F5 .
- После этого запишите в ячейке следующую формулу.
=SUMPRODUCT(($C$5:$C$16>=DATEVALUE("1/1/1990"))*($C$5:$C$16<=DATEVALUE("12/31/1990")))
- Теперь нажмите Войти .
- Аналогичным образом вставьте формулу такого же типа в оставшуюся часть ячейки с F6:F10 .
- Вы увидите, что формула вычислит количество лет, как в предыдущем примере.
Поэтому мы можем сказать, что наша формула работает точно, и мы можем считать между двумя датами.
🔎 Разбивка формулы
Мы разбиваем формулу для ячейки F5 .
👉
ЗНАЧЕНИЕ ДАТЫ("1/1/1990") : The DATEVALUE функция преобразует числовое значение в значение даты. Здесь значение имеет вид 1/1/1990 .
👉
DATEVALUE(“12/31/1990”) : The DATEVALUE функция преобразует числовое значение в значение даты. Для этой функции значение будет таким 12/31/1990 .
👉
SUMPRODUCT(($C$5:$C$16>=DATEVALUE("1/1/1990"))*($C$5:$C$16<=DATEVALUE("12/31/1990"))) : The СУМПРОДУКТЫ функция подсчитает значение дат, которые лежат между датой 1/1/1990 и 12/31/1990 Здесь значение 1 .
Читать далее: Как использовать COUNTIF для диапазона дат в Excel (6 подходящих подходов)
4. подсчет между любым заданным диапазоном дат
В последнем примере мы узнаем количество дат в диапазоне дат, используя функция COUNTIFS Наш желаемый диапазон дат находится в диапазоне ячеек E5:F5 .
Ниже приводится пошаговое описание процедуры:
📌 Шаги:
- Во-первых, выберите ячейку G5 .
- Затем запишите в ячейке следующую формулу.
=COUNTIFS($C$5:$C$16,">="&E5,$C$5:$C$16,"<="&F5)
- После этого нажмите Войти .
- Вы получите общее количество сущностей в ячейке G5 .
Наконец, мы можем сказать, что наша формула работает успешно, и мы можем использовать COUNTIF функция для подсчета между двумя датами.
Применение функции COUNTIF между двумя датами с несколькими критериями
Помимо предыдущих примеров, мы покажем вам процедуру использования функции ДАТА и КОУНТИФЫ функции для подсчета количества дат по нескольким критериям. Шаги этой процедуры приведены ниже:
📌 Шаги:
- В начале выделите ячейку F5 .
- Теперь запишите в ячейке следующую формулу.
=COUNTIFS($C$5:$C$16,">="&DATE(E5,1,1),$C$5:$C$16,"<="&DATE(E5,12,31))
- Нажмите Войти .
- После этого, перетащить сайт Наполнительная рукоятка значок , чтобы скопировать формулу в ячейку F10 .
- Вы получите все количество расчетных лет на нужных нам клетках.
Наконец, мы можем сказать, что наша формула работает плодотворно, и мы можем использовать КОУНТИФЫ функция для подсчета между двумя датами по нескольким критериям.
🔎 Разбивка формулы
Мы разбиваем формулу для ячейки F5 .
👉
DATE(E5,1,1) : The ДАТА функция преобразует числовое значение в значение даты. Здесь значение имеет вид 1/1/1990 .
👉
DATE(E5,12,31) : The ДАТА функция преобразует числовое значение в значение даты. Для этой функции значение будет таким 12/31/1990 .
👉
COUNTIFS($C$5:$C$16,">="&DATE(E5,1,1),$C$5:$C$16,"<="&DATE(E5,12,31)) : Функция COUNTIFS подсчитывает те значения дат, которые лежат между датой 1/1/1990 и 12/31/1990. Здесь значение 1 .
Использование функции COUNTIF между двумя датами с критериями совпадения
В этом случае мы узнаем точное количество дат в нашем наборе данных, используя функция COUNTIF Дата, которую мы собираемся искать, это ячейка E5 .
Ниже приводится пошаговое описание процедуры:
📌 Шаги:
- В начале выберите ячейку F5 .
- После этого запишите в ячейке следующую формулу.
=COUNTIF($C$5:$C$16,E5)
- Нажмите кнопку Войти ключ.
- Вы заметите, что общее количество сущностей в ячейке F5 .
В итоге мы можем сказать, что наша формула работает правильно, и мы можем использовать функцию COUNTIF функция для подсчета между двумя датами при совпадении критериев.
Заключение
На этом я заканчиваю эту статью, надеюсь, что она будет вам полезна и вы сможете использовать COUNTIF функция для подсчета между двумя датами в Excel. Пожалуйста, если у вас возникли дополнительные вопросы или рекомендации, поделитесь с нами в разделе комментариев ниже.
Не забудьте заглянуть на наш сайт, ExcelWIKI для решения нескольких проблем, связанных с Excel. Продолжайте изучать новые методы и развивайтесь!